What are the key skills and qualifications needed to thrive with an associate's degree in computer science?

To thrive with an Associate Degree in Computer Science, foundational knowledge in programming, algorithms, and computer systems is essential, typically supported by coursework or certifications in languages like Python, Java, or C++. Familiarity with version control systems (e.g., Git), database management, and basic networking concepts is commonly expected. Problem-solving ability, attention to detail, and teamwork are important soft skills that help individuals excel in technical and collaborative settings. These skills and qualifications enable graduates to effectively contribute to software development, IT support, or other technology-driven roles.

What can you do with an associate's degree in computer science?

With an associate's degree in computer science, you can pursue entry-level roles such as computer support specialist, web developer, or junior programmer. This degree provides foundational knowledge in programming, databases, and IT support, making you eligible for jobs in a variety of industries. Many graduates also use it as a stepping stone to a bachelor's degree in computer science or a related field.

What types of entry-level roles are available for someone with an associate's degree in computer science, and how do these positions typically support team projects?

With an associate's degree in computer science, you can pursue entry-level positions such as IT support specialist, junior programmer, help desk technician, or network support technician. These roles often involve working closely with other team members to troubleshoot technical issues, assist in software development, or maintain network systems. Collaboration is key, as you'll regularly communicate with developers, system administrators, and end-users to ensure smooth operations and resolve problems efficiently. Teamwork and clear communication are essential, and many employers offer opportunities for on-the-job learning and advancement into higher technical roles.

Radiance is seeking a talented Software Engineer to support the development, integration, and optimization of advanced scientific computing applications and Electro-Optical & Infrared (EO/IR) sensor Modeling and Simulation (M&S) technologies. This role will contribute to the evaluation, development, and integration of capabilities within an existing MATLAB and Rust software environment. In this role you will work closely with a team of software engineers and subject matter experts to extend and integrate physics-based M&S capabilities.

The ideal candidate will have strong scientific programming experience, proficiency with compiled languages, and experience working in Linux and Windows environments. Experience with Rust, CUDA, and high-performance computing is highly desirable. This position is ideal for a software engineer interested in scientific computing, high-performance software development, and next-generation sensing technologies.

Responsibilities

  • Develop and maintain scientific computing software applications.

  • Evaluate existing EO/IR camera models developing improvements for accuracy and efficiency.

  • Design, develop, and integrate solutions into existing software frameworks.

  • Develop and integrate custom physics-based models under the guidance of phenomenology subject matter experts.

  • Collaborate with multidisciplinary teams to integrate capabilities into existing Rust codebases.

  • Convert and optimize existing MATLAB code bases into compiled RUST applications for CPU and GPU processing.

  • Optimize computational performance for CPU- and GPU-based applications.

  • Contribute to software testing, validation, and continuous integration and deployment (CI/CD) efforts.

  • Utilize version control and software development best practices throughout the development lifecycle.

  • Support deployment and operational use of developed algorithms and software solutions.

Required Qualifications

  • US Citizen, eligible and willing to obtain a TS/SCI Security Clearance.

  • Bachelor's degree in Computer Science, Software Engineering, Electrical Engineering, Physics, Mathematics, or a related technical field.

  • Experience with scientific programming and computational software development.

  • Proficiency with one or more compiled programming languages (such as C++, Rust, or similar).

  • Experience developing software in both Linux and Windows environments.

  • Experience with one or more scientific computing tools, including MATLAB and or Python.

  • Experience using Git or other version control systems.

Preferred Qualifications

  • Rust software development, including at least two years of experience developing and deploying operational Rust applications or algorithms.

  • GPU acceleration and optimization using CUDA.

  • CPU performance optimization and high-performance computing techniques.

  • Continuous Integration/Continuous Deployment (CI/CD) pipelines and DevOps practices.

  • Real-time signal processing, sensor modeling, or simulation environments.

  • Event-based cameras or event-based sensing technologies.

  • Experience working with EO/IR sensor data and radiative transfer models.

  • Understanding of EO/IR sensor phenomenology and atmospheric effects.
